Compare Walla Walla to Longview

This post compares Walla Walla, Washington to Longview, Washington across various dimensions, including population, median income, median age, percentage of housing that is rental, percent of households with kids, and other demographics.

Dimension Walla Walla (city) Longview (city)
Population 32,585 36,740
Income (median) $40,863 $41,546
Home Value (median) $178,800 $165,600
White 82% 87%
Black 2% 1%
Asian 2% 1%
With Kids 27% 26%
Age (median) 35 40
Rentals 42% 46%
